The Problem with Sky Stream is its reused Puck
You end up sending them back and then Sky repackage them in new packaging to make them look new, when they are not, same problem with Sky Q, but if they didn't do it, they would end up in landfill or on eBay, they should mark them as used, beecause you do not know how long someone else has used it for and it would take Sky ages to cheack every puck that comes in so why some do not work as intended.
No one is perfect, not even Sky... 🙂
I have Sky Steam and never had a problem with it, only bit I do not like is the standby after 3 hours and have to move the remote and it going on standby when you pause live TV for 10 minutes(make something to eat and come back and its off so have to keep it playing to keep it on so then have to rewind it), when it really shouln't becuase it makes no sence.

Re: The Problem with Sky Stream is its reused Puck
@spannernick1 wrote:
it would take Sky ages to cheack every puck that comes in so why some do not work as intended.
All returned hardware which is likely to be going out again gets a standard multi-stage check at the bit of Unipart Logistics which has the Sky refurbishment contract.

Re: The Problem with Sky Stream is its reused Puck
It's worth noting that Sky replace the case and any internal components that don't pass the testing. saying that years ago I had a replacement Sky+ box and it still had the previous customers recordings on it! so clearly they used to not do extensive testing.
